Differences between ginger and soursop
- Ginger has more copper, vitamin B6, and magnesium, while soursop has more vitamin C and fiber.
- Soursop's daily need coverage for vitamin C is 17% higher.
- Soursop contains 4 times less choline than ginger. Ginger contains 28.8mg of choline, while soursop contains 7.6mg.
- The amount of sugar in ginger is lower.
- Ginger has a lower glycemic index. The glycemic index of ginger is 10, while the glycemic index of soursop is 32.
The food types used in this comparison are Ginger root, raw and Soursop, raw.
